Refurbished Laptops



Refurbished LaptopsRefurbished laptops offer one of the best-looking types of deal for people looking for their next laptop private computer. Refurbished laptops are second-hand laptops which have been purchased from users by special laptop renovate companies, and are then repaired to service condition and sold for more lesser rate on the internet. By choosing to pay money for refurbished laptops over used laptops directly from users, you get the safety of knowing that the laptop will run when it reach your at your destination.
This formulates buying refurbished laptops are safer investment than simply purchasing a used laptop direct off a site like eBay, Nextag etc. Refurbished laptops are a large element of the online laptop industry, and there are many places that you can find refurbished laptops. Here are some thoughts to help you in your search for contemptible refurbished laptops online.
Your refurbished laptop can be basically any model.
As long as you are comfy with using technology that may be up to a year or too big than the latest laptop computers, a refurbished notebook represents a grand deal. Refurbished laptop computers can be procured on sites like www.usedlaptops.com or www.overstock.com. These sites have a broad range of refurbished notebook computers in all of the brands which are available for very reasonable prices.

The refurbished notebooks that you can find by just searching for "refurbished laptops" on Google, Yahoo are priced in the range of merely a few hundred dollars, and this is for a smarten up laptop computer that is generally no more than about one year old. Refurbished wholesale laptops are obtainable in all countries; you can get a laptop refurbished in the UK or France throughout Europe, or in the United States.
Getting your own laptop refurbished may be an alternative if you have had difficulty with getting newer software to operate, but don't want to go through the troubles of reinstalling everything on a new laptop. By getting your laptop refurnished, you may be able to carry it up to standards again. You may also sell your own older laptop to be refurbished and use the cash towards a newer laptop.

Nikon D2X | Digital Camera Review | Camera




















One of the most important requirements for the Nikon D2X is a solid housing.
And the D2X digital reflex certainly is a solid camera. Although it looks rather compressed it still looks nice. Characteristic is the familiar red border.
The D1X was based on the Nikon F5 but the tables are turned with the D2X. The analogue Nikon F6 is based on the D-SLR. Just like the D2H and D1X, the Nikon D2X features a built-in vertical handgrip. It makes the camera larger and at the same time it offers a perfect hand-fit.
Horizontally as well as vertically the D2X offers a good grip. Holding the Nikon D2X really gives you the feeling that you're working with a real robust digital tool.


Nikon D2X digital reflex camera
When we take a look at the front side of the digital reflex camera, the appearance of the Nikon D2X is beautiful. Remarkable is the white balance sensor on top of the viewfinder. Left on the handgrip the familiar red border is found. On top of this border the command dial is found to adjust aperture among other things.

A similar dial is also found on the bottom side of the handgrip, meant for photographing in vertical mode. Left from the bayonet mount two buttons are placed. One serves as check button for the depth of field. Pressing it you will hear about the exact same sound as when taking a picture. Below this button a programmable button is placed.

On the right of the metal bayonet, the Nikon D2X contains the lens unlock with below it the switch for the focus modes. It has been like this since the first auto focus Nikon, the F501 from 1985. "Never change a winning team." Top right the indicator LED for the self-timer is positioned with below it the connection for a studio flash light.

And below that a ten pin connector for remote control. Both connections are hidden behind small caps which unfortunately get lost easily with most photographers. You just tend to loose these caps once you have removed them, at least that is what happens to me! Nikon D2X SLR - Rubber protection & connections In order to prevent loosing these caps, the inside of the two rubber protection lids feature two holders for the caps.

You just have to know this fact! Behind the rubber the connections for audio/video are found, the DC-in and the USB connection. The rubber covers don't turn away and when closed they shut everything off perfectly. It's one of the many protections used against dust and water. In the bottom of the handgrip the battery is placed and this holder is also equipped with a rubber protection.

Nikon D2X digital reflex -
Back side of the camera The back of the Nikon D2X offers a busy vista; you hardly see the camera through the many buttons. Top left we start with the play button, with right next to it the recycle bin. If the delete button is depressed with the Mode button on top of the camera at the same time, the memory card can be deleted very fast.

A bit above the lens we find the lever to close the lens. The rubber ring around the lens can only be removed when the lens is closed. A simple but very effective way to prevent you from loosing the eye shell. A bit more to the right the AE/AF lock and AF-ON button are found.

This latter one serves to activate the focus. Especially handy when you're dealing with moving objects. Completely on the right the Commend dial is positioned.

Nikon D2X SLR camera -
LCD monitor In the centre the large sized 2.5 inch LCD monitor is positioned, protected by a separate cap, protective and transparent. In a row below the monitor we find: the menu button, the button for reproduction of thumbnails, security and help button, enter button/play zoom button and finally a loudspeaker.

Right from the loudspeaker a second LCD is placed for rendering a number of digital settings. Below another row of buttons is placed. From left to right these are the buttons for sensitivity, image quality size and white balance and the last one is the microphone. To the right from the lowest monitor the button to activate the microphone is placed so you can add some comments to your photos. Above it the button for selecting auto focus areas is placed.

Dominating is the tumble switch to select the AF areas or scroll through a photo. Entirely on the right the door to the memory compartment is found, equipped with a rubber edge. The cover can be opened by pressing the unlock button on the left below the door. A fine and safe security to prevent from accidentally opening the door, without it costing too much time to open it.

A lot of thought has been put into it! Finally on the back of the camera bottom right, we find a second AF-ON button and a second command dial, which come in very handy when taking vertical images. It would have also been handy to place a second AE/AF lock. That brings us to the end of our tour of the camera's back, but we're not finished yet with the entire camera.

Nikon D2X SLR -
More buttons… On top we find a few more buttons starting on the left.
Here we find an unlock button to enable turning the dial for image speed. On top of the dial some buttons for bracketing, lock settings and flash sync are placed.

The standard hot shoe is placed on top of the viewfinder. And on the right the button to select light metering and dioptre setting are placed. The right side is dominated by a large sized LCD that renders the shooting settings.

On top of the handgrip the Mode button for exposure programmes and a button for exposure correction are positioned. Obviously the release button is found at front with around it the main switch to activate the camera.

- Release button When we view the camera on the right side, we find a second release button on the bottom with around it a switch to activate the release button. Finally we find the metal tripod at the bottom of the camera and a cover that hides the connection for the optional WiFi adaptor.
